diff options
author | Jelmer Vernooij <jelmer@samba.org> | 2006-04-24 15:47:59 +0000 |
---|---|---|
committer | Gerald (Jerry) Carter <jerry@samba.org> | 2007-10-10 14:04:18 -0500 |
commit | 69b51f702af1ded825d5c17bdb97014cac12e752 (patch) | |
tree | 2aaae15c6b5cf81298442501c2f7c3cfaa761221 /source4/smbd | |
parent | 758946429e8cef84ebc00e02f6fa0fb93a642aa8 (diff) | |
download | samba-69b51f702af1ded825d5c17bdb97014cac12e752.tar.gz samba-69b51f702af1ded825d5c17bdb97014cac12e752.tar.bz2 samba-69b51f702af1ded825d5c17bdb97014cac12e752.zip |
r15207: Introduce PRIVATE_DEPENDENCIES and PUBLIC_DEPENDENCIES as replacement
for REQUIRED_SUBSYSTEMS.
(This used to be commit adc8a019b6da256f104abed1b82bfde6998a2ac9)
Diffstat (limited to 'source4/smbd')
-rw-r--r-- | source4/smbd/config.mk | 24 | ||||
-rw-r--r-- | source4/smbd/process_model.mk | 4 |
2 files changed, 14 insertions, 14 deletions
diff --git a/source4/smbd/config.mk b/source4/smbd/config.mk index 9f47e20e5e..3033ed1bb0 100644 --- a/source4/smbd/config.mk +++ b/source4/smbd/config.mk @@ -5,7 +5,7 @@ [MODULE::service_auth] INIT_FUNCTION = server_service_auth_init SUBSYSTEM = service -REQUIRED_SUBSYSTEMS = \ +PUBLIC_DEPENDENCIES = \ auth # End MODULE server_auth ################################################ @@ -16,7 +16,7 @@ REQUIRED_SUBSYSTEMS = \ INIT_FUNCTION = server_service_smb_init OUTPUT_TYPE = MERGEDOBJ SUBSYSTEM = service -REQUIRED_SUBSYSTEMS = \ +PUBLIC_DEPENDENCIES = \ SMB_SERVER # End MODULE server_smb ################################################ @@ -27,7 +27,7 @@ REQUIRED_SUBSYSTEMS = \ INIT_FUNCTION = server_service_rpc_init SUBSYSTEM = service OUTPUT_TYPE = MERGEDOBJ -REQUIRED_SUBSYSTEMS = \ +PUBLIC_DEPENDENCIES = \ dcerpc_server # End MODULE server_rpc ################################################ @@ -37,7 +37,7 @@ REQUIRED_SUBSYSTEMS = \ [MODULE::service_ldap] INIT_FUNCTION = server_service_ldap_init SUBSYSTEM = service -REQUIRED_SUBSYSTEMS = \ +PUBLIC_DEPENDENCIES = \ LDAP # End MODULE server_ldap ################################################ @@ -47,7 +47,7 @@ REQUIRED_SUBSYSTEMS = \ [MODULE::service_nbtd] INIT_FUNCTION = server_service_nbtd_init SUBSYSTEM = service -REQUIRED_SUBSYSTEMS = \ +PUBLIC_DEPENDENCIES = \ NBTD # End MODULE service_nbtd ################################################ @@ -57,7 +57,7 @@ REQUIRED_SUBSYSTEMS = \ [MODULE::service_wrepl] INIT_FUNCTION = server_service_wrepl_init SUBSYSTEM = service -REQUIRED_SUBSYSTEMS = \ +PUBLIC_DEPENDENCIES = \ WREPL_SRV # End MODULE service_wrepl ################################################ @@ -67,7 +67,7 @@ REQUIRED_SUBSYSTEMS = \ [MODULE::service_cldap] INIT_FUNCTION = server_service_cldapd_init SUBSYSTEM = service -REQUIRED_SUBSYSTEMS = \ +PUBLIC_DEPENDENCIES = \ CLDAPD # End MODULE service_cldapd ################################################ @@ -77,7 +77,7 @@ REQUIRED_SUBSYSTEMS = \ [MODULE::service_web] INIT_FUNCTION = server_service_web_init SUBSYSTEM = service -REQUIRED_SUBSYSTEMS = \ +PUBLIC_DEPENDENCIES = \ WEB # End MODULE service_web ################################################ @@ -87,7 +87,7 @@ REQUIRED_SUBSYSTEMS = \ [MODULE::service_kdc] INIT_FUNCTION = server_service_kdc_init SUBSYSTEM = service -REQUIRED_SUBSYSTEMS = \ +PUBLIC_DEPENDENCIES = \ KDC # End MODULE service_web ################################################ @@ -97,7 +97,7 @@ REQUIRED_SUBSYSTEMS = \ [MODULE::service_winbind] INIT_FUNCTION = server_service_winbind_init SUBSYSTEM = service -REQUIRED_SUBSYSTEMS = \ +PUBLIC_DEPENDENCIES = \ WINBIND # End MODULE service_winbind ################################################ @@ -110,7 +110,7 @@ OBJ_FILES = \ service.o \ service_stream.o \ service_task.o -REQUIRED_SUBSYSTEMS = \ +PUBLIC_DEPENDENCIES = \ MESSAGING # End SUBSYSTEM SERVER ####################### @@ -122,7 +122,7 @@ INSTALLDIR = SBINDIR MANPAGE = smbd.8 OBJ_FILES = \ server.o -REQUIRED_SUBSYSTEMS = \ +PRIVATE_DEPENDENCIES = \ process_model \ service \ LIBSAMBA-CONFIG \ diff --git a/source4/smbd/process_model.mk b/source4/smbd/process_model.mk index 0d29e20c0f..cf6b02dccc 100644 --- a/source4/smbd/process_model.mk +++ b/source4/smbd/process_model.mk @@ -17,7 +17,7 @@ INIT_FUNCTION = process_model_standard_init SUBSYSTEM = process_model OBJ_FILES = \ process_standard.o -REQUIRED_SUBSYSTEMS = EXT_LIB_SETPROCTITLE +PUBLIC_DEPENDENCIES = EXT_LIB_SETPROCTITLE # End MODULE process_model_standard ################################################ @@ -28,7 +28,7 @@ INIT_FUNCTION = process_model_thread_init SUBSYSTEM = process_model OBJ_FILES = \ process_thread.o -REQUIRED_SUBSYSTEMS = EXT_LIB_PTHREAD +PUBLIC_DEPENDENCIES = EXT_LIB_PTHREAD # End MODULE process_model_thread ################################################ |